We're back with another maker feature. These are so much fun and we love sharing the fun details of handmade Canadian companies. This month, we're introducing you to Andrea and her business - North of Esme. Such a fun interview, we're glad she decided to do one with us. We won't spill on what exactly she makes, you'll have to read on to find out for yourself. But, we do love how unique her company is and that she is saving items from making it to the landfill. Let's not wait any longer, here's the full interview.




What is your name and company?
Andrea - North of Esme
 
Where are you from?  
Qualicum Beach, BC

What do you make?
Dresses

Where can we find you and start shopping?
Instagram: @northofesme
Shop: DM through Instagram

Does your company contribute back to the environment?
We use repurposed fabrics and laces.




The business side of the interview...

Tell us more about your company - what's your business' story or something unique that we'd love to hear?

North of Esme was created from my love of dressing up and feeling glamorous combined with my passion for seeking out unique and beautiful fabrics that may otherwise end up in the landfill. I aim to make affordable dresses that fit a wide range of women. Sometimes putting on a dress and getting a little dolled up can do a world of wonders for your mood. Being home on maternity leave, with my second babe has somehow provided me with more inspiration to follow my heart and passion and create some beautiful garments for you to wear.

How did you get started selling? What made you finally take the leap?

I am actually just getting started with dress rentals and sales. With all that is going on in the world right now, I had initially decided to push back launching anything, but I noticed that people are still living and documenting the beauty of life and wanted to make my dresses available for this.




Are you a full time or part time maker? Either scenario, tell us what a day in business looks like for you?

I am a part time maker. I’m currently on maternity leave and have a two year old and a 7 month old. When I’m not on leave I work as a registered nurse, but the goal is to go back part time and keep making dresses part time.

Finding moments here and there, in between naps and at bedtime is when I get my sewing in! There is no typical day, being a maker with young children at home is unpredictable and I’m working really hard to find some balance in that.

What does your dream storefront look like? Is it online or brick and mortar, do you work all week long, do you have employees, etc?

I would love to have a little studio store front on our property. Lots of windows and great light, somewhere close to the garden. People could come and try on dresses and even take photos in the garden if they wanted! I would work around the children’s schedules and take appointments for try ons.
